Sweet 16 party.
Last Saturday afternoon my niece had her 16th birthday party. She choose to have a chocolate cake with a lavender fondant with a strawberry filling. YUM! Sorry, I didn't get a shot of the filling...


One of her interests currently is Ballywood dancing which is what inspired me to make her the journal below.  I used a plain spiral bound notebook. I took an image of Ballywood dancers, with the help of Photoshop, I removed the face of one of the dancers and replaced it with a picture of my niece. I added some text to the image.  I added some pretty pink decorative paper and silk ribbons to the outside front. A map of India (notice the pink) is on the outside back cover. I added a few other items to the inside including the bright pink envelope containing a birthday card and money gift.


 
Then I wrapped it in a piece of shimmery fabric. The fabric will be fun to wear while dancing.


Of course it had a pink bow!

Tag Tuesday April 12, 2011

"A chair."
Rebecca (Bellesouth@blogspot.com) from the Blog Challenge Garden selected a chair as the theme for our Tag Tuesday Challenge this week.
The chair I used is one that I rescued and revived several years ago. You may recognize it from the header on my blog. I pulled the photo into Photoshop and altered it with the posterize filter. The background paper on my tag was from packaging material. I used Inkadinkado letter stamps to make the word sit. I added word bubbles with the quote, "Come sit with me and stay awhile and we shall have some tea". It is one of the quotes that is actually painted on the chair. A little Stickles glitter was used to outline the letters.
